EXCLUSIVE: The 9-1-1 Might 1 episode “The Final Alarm,” through which Athena and Station 118 bid farewell to Captain Bobby Nash (Peter Krause), drew 9.18 million complete viewers and a 1.75 ranking amongst Adults 18-49 in Reside+7 multi-platform viewing on ABC, Hulu, Hulu on Disney+ and digital platforms.
That was up in each complete viewers (+9%; vs. 8.45 million) and adults 18-49 (+1%; vs. 1.74 ranking) over the earlier episode that led to Bobby’s surprising loss of life to attain the hearth fighter drama’s strongest numbers in each classes since November (11/7/24).
On linear, “The Final Alarm” delivered 6.48 million complete viewers and a 0.63 adults 18-49 ranking, additionally rising over the earlier episode in each viewers (+15%; vs. 5.64 million) and 18-49 (+13%; vs. 0.56 ranking) to submit 9-1-1’s greatest numbers since March – since 3/27/25.
